Not overly expressive on the nose upon opening. There’s hints of cassis, ripe raspberry, dark cherry, wet soil, and vanilla. This wine explodes on the palate. Medium plus body, with grippy tannin and moderate acidity. This is well made and will last for decades. It’s delicious now but still very young and primary. Drinks like a 2016. Hold for another 5 if you have the patience.

Sunday Dinner on the Beach (Yin Yang Coastal, Ting Kau Village, Tsuen Wan, Kowloon, Hong Kong): Decanted for 2 hours - not enough. Totally opaque black-red in colour. Nose is lush and really deep - classic clean and precise Colgin signature. Similar palate - silky and succulent and very poised but rather too primary at the moment. Good length but can only get a whole lot better. More fruit-driven than the 2002 I drank with Ann Colgin a year ago. Preferred not to score it as didn't give it enough contemplation.

Decanted 3,5 hrs. Lighter and older looking than expected, dense, 89;80. Heady nose of exotic spices, earth, mint and sweet black currants. Firmer structure than normally from Colgin and a bit darker and more brooding. Less of the exuberant, exotic, explosive flavors (although some is still there). Cocoa, cinnamon, Long aftertaste with pronounced bitterness but also a lot of sweet fruit. Great wine, but personally I prefer the more flamboyant style of other vintages.
